Tamils in Vadamarachchi held a vigil at Point Pedro beach on Wednesday evening in memory of protesters in Thoothukudi shot dead by Tamil Nadu police.
The event was organised by the Tamil National People's Front.
Nine people were killed and 65 injured on Tuesday in Tamil Nadu after police opened fire at protesters in Thoothukudi, who had been seeking a ban on Sterlite Industries' copper plant.
The protesters, who launched their protest many months ago, accuse Sterlite Industries of releasing pollutants from its plants and have been demanding the plant be closed.
